  1. QUOTE(ptatc @ Jun 16, 2006 -> 01:50 PM) This type of thing is common for pitcher's with back pain. The pitchers don't flex the spine enough to finish the pitches and they leave the ball up. This in turn leads to more flyballs, increased HRs and decreased Ks. If hermie gets him on a good rehab program there is a chance for him to return to the Riske of old condidering he in only 28 and not losing his stuff.
